Myth: Bariatric
surgery is a stomach staple
A stomach staple is only one of the many surgical procedures termed
"bariatric," and these procedures employ a variety of methods. Some
can reduce the functioning size of the stomach, and others bypass parts of the
digestive tract, which reduces the absorption of calories and nutrients. Each
kind of surgery has its own unique benefits, and one of our esteemed doctors
will help you find the one that is best for your health.
Myth:
Bariatric surgery is very dangerous
Every surgery will involve some kind of health risk – even very minor
procedures that occur in a doctor's office. There have been a number of
advances in the world of weight loss surgery, and each one is designed to improve
the safety of the patients. Recent developments in this field of surgery have
resulted in faster healing, less scarring, and even less pain and recovery time
after the surgery is over.
When you consider the benefits of weight loss surgery, some risks can
seem more than worth it. After all, many of the people considering the surgery
are morbidly obese and face related conditions such as diabetes, hypertension,
high blood pressure, sleep apnea, and breathing problems. All of these can
significantly shorten your lifespan, so you're taking a risk if you don't get the surgery.
Myth:
Bariatric surgery is a quick fix
Some people think that weight loss surgery means that they'll be able to
instantly shed pounds and not have to make any serious lifestyle changes. However,
these procedures are not a substitute for diet and exercise; weight loss surgery
is a last resort when traditional methods have failed. In fact, your doctor
will have you on a very strict diet and exercise regimen after the surgery
(especially during the first few months) to manage your weight loss and keep
you healthy. So make no mistake: bariatric surgery is a big-time commitment.
The good news is that the reward of a healthy body and a longer lifespan are
well worth it!
